Georgian College of Applied Arts and Technology, Canada, is a public college in Ontario. The institution runs courses at various postgraduate levels and specialises in market-drive programs. Some of the leading courses at Georgian include Engineering, Health, Food and Hospitality, Business and Telecommunications.

The college opened in 1967 to provide post-secondary learning opportunities to local students. However, Georgian has grown to offer higher education for over 13,000 full-time students and international students from over 60 different countries.

At Georgian College of Applied Arts and Technology, students have several on-campus and off-campus housing options. First, students can select the on-campus accommodation option. However, these are only available for those located at the Barrie, Orillia and Owen Sound campuses. Alternatively, the college can support students with finding a landlord or host family to stay with off-campus. Georgina staff also have resources and tips available to help you safely find somewhere to stay off campus.

Employability

Georgian College currently has one of the highest graduate employment rates among Ontario colleges. Recently, 90.3% of Georgian alumni found work within six months of graduation, which is above the provincial average. In addition, employers reported 100% satisfaction for the second year in a row for Georgian graduates. Whilst studying, students also get the opportunity to work with about 6,200 employers across Canada within the college network.

In recent years, the Georgian College of Applied Arts and Technology has offered students over $3 million in financial aid. The college has over 650 scholarship and aid options for students. In addition, the institution has financial support programmes specifically for international students, regardless of their degree level. These include in-course awards and entrance awards.
